#2d9a00 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2d9a00 is composed of 17.6% red, 60.4% green and 0%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 70.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 100% yellow and 39.6% black. It has a hue angle of 102.5 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 30.2%. #2d9a00 color hex could be obtained by blending #5aff00 with #003500. Closest websafe color is: #339900.

Shades and Tints of #2d9a00
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#051100 is the darkest color, while #fdfffc is the lightest one.

Tones of #2d9a00
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4b5347 is the less saturated color, while #2d9a00 is the most saturated one.
